Baldock Train Station comes with essential amenities to make your journey smooth and comfortable. It has a ticket office operational from early in the morning until early afternoon on weekdays and Saturdays, although it is not open on Sundays. For those who prefer pre-booking tickets online, ticket collection is available through accessible ticket machines designed to cater for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ts too.
There are help points scattered across the station for timely assistance, although note that staff are available only during certain hours. Be mindful that the station lacks step-free access, which might be a point to consider for anyone with mobility restrictions. Unfortunately, there are no waiting rooms, refreshments, or luggage storage facilities, so planning ahead is crucial. On the flip side, the station is secured with CCTV for added safety.

At Hayes Station, ticket purchasing is straightforward, with a ticket office open during the week and on Saturdays, complemented by ticket machines and accessible facilities in the booking hall. If you're planning to collect tickets bought online, this is easily done at the station's machines. Furthermore, for those using smartcards, Hayes Station supports both issuance and validation. On the security front, the station boasts full CCTV coverage and has received Secure station accreditation.
The station provides a help point, with staff assistance available during business hours from Monday to Saturday. Although there is no provision for luggage storage, accessible toilets and essential seating are available, contributing to a comfortable travel environment. Step-free access partial facilities ensure a good degree of ease for those who might need it, with specific ramps strategically located with accessibility in mind.
When it comes to travel sustainability, Hayes makes strides with cycle storage facilities available. Although there are no cycle hire services, the station's 20 cycle spaces are sheltered, keeping your bike safe from the elements. Refreshment amenities are also at hand with a coffee shop and vending machines, although cash facilities are not present.
